We're committed to making Lessons Mama Never Taught Me accessible to every reader. The app targets WCAG 2.2 Level AA and is tested against the following assistive technologies:
- VoiceOver on iOS and macOS (Safari)
- TalkBack on Android (Chrome)
- NVDA and JAWS on Windows (Edge / Firefox / Chrome)
Built-in reading preferences
Open the Aa menu in the top bar to:
- Scale the body font from 90% to 140%
- Turn on high-contrast mode (black on white, underlined links)
- Switch to a dyslexia-friendly typeface
- Reduce motion and animation
Preferences save to your device and apply to every page. The app also honors your system's prefers-reduced-motion and prefers-contrast settings on first visit.

Keyboard navigation
Every interactive element is reachable with Tab and operable withEnter / Space. A skip-to-content link appears on first focus.
